AWS/EC2
AWS EC2 Linux2 에 Docker 설치하기
DOGvelopers
2020. 4. 4. 09:36
반응형
- yum 업데이트
sudo yum update -y
- Docker 설치
최신 Docker community Edition 패키지 설치
sudo amazon-linux-extras install docker
- 도커 시작
sudo service docker start
- 권한
ec2-user를 사용하지 않고도 도커 명령을 실행할 수 있도록 docker 그룹에 sudo를 추가합니다.
sudo usermod -a -G docker ec2-user
로그아웃하고 다시 로그인해서 새 docker 그룹 권한을 선택합니다. 이를 위해 현재 SSH 터미널 창을 닫고 새 창에서 인스턴스를 다시 연결할 수 있습니다. 새 SSH 세션은 해당되는 docker 그룹 권한을 갖게 됩니다.
- 또는 밑의 명령어
sudo setfacl -m user:ec2-user:rw /var/run/docker.sock
- 확인
docker info
- 문제
Cannot connect to the Docker daemon. Is the docker daemon running on this host?
- 해결
ssh 재접속
aws홈페이지에서 제공해주는 기본사항입니다. 일단 시작이 반이니 한번 해보시는 걸 추천합니다!!ㅎㅎ 모두 즐코 하세요
https://docs.aws.amazon.com/ko_kr/AmazonECS/latest/developerguide/docker-basics.html
반응형